What evidence can you share that demonstrates the impact of the engagement?

Before Starfish came on board, we were facing a restrictive, competitive market for pilots and seeing a long decline in our ability to hire them. This year, we achieved a 35% increase in our success rate. Starfish also convinced our executive team to approve the employee brand strategy within five months. This incredibly fast turnaround rate speaks to their proactiveness and strategic nature.

How did Starfish perform from a project management standpoint?

We were dealing with high-pressure tasks and deadlines, and Starfish remained nimble throughout the process. If we called them up and asked for a job to be done by tomorrow, they usually said yes.

We could also challenge them to work creatively around our constraints. For example, one of the central components of our pilot recruitment campaign was stand-out photography. However, I didn’t have the budget to staff and run a full photoshoot. 

Starfish and I put our heads together, and we ended up running the photoshoot virtually. We had a photographer on set and the creative director over the phone, and they’d coordinate on shots through quick iPhone pictures. It ended up working well without going over my budget.

**O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E**
What challenge were you trying to address with Starfish?

We used Starfish to help us build a stronger employer brand and to help embed our brand and value proposition inwardly at key employee touchpoints throughout their career at our organization (from onboarding to retirement or when they exit the firm).

**SOLUTION**
What was the scope of their involvement?

They developed a proprietary model for understanding and identifying key brand touchpoints within our organization, in terms of where the brand intersects with employees and clients. Starfish developed a strategy for us to map out these brand identity spots or touchpoints. We were able to classify them and figure out a strategy behind each one so that the impact would be meaningful for our employees.

Together with Starfish, we developed a communication strategy that included design elements, messaging, visual expression and videos, etc. for the 10th-anniversary celebration of our merger. On another occasion, we created a campaign around PwC's rebranding efforts. It included creating physical installations in over 80 U.S. offices to allow our people to interact and learn about all the elements of the brand. Both of these efforts created a unique brand experience for our people making them feel pride in the firm.

Starfish helped us to develop a full recruiting campaign for college campuses, from the creative, to the messaging, to the strategy, to the full installation and the research behind it. This helped candidates associate a sense of purpose, opportunity and satisfaction with the type of work they could be doing for us.

Finally, they helped us make sure that the content on our website reflected our new language and positioning, as well as updating our sales tools and collateral material. In some cases, our collateral material needed customization (a unique look and feel) in order to differentiate it from the competition and to set it apart from other existing service offerings. Starfish accomplished this many times using their knowledge of our brand and visual guidelines. Many of these assignments were to help support a new service offering we were launching or to refresh an existing service offering for relaunch.

**RESULTS & FEEDBACK**
What evidence can you share that demonstrates the impact of the engagement?

We’ve made a strong effort to increase awareness of our company on campuses and to hopefully become an employer of choice. There is an outside ranking organization that surveys students to determine the top "employer of choice" on US campuses. PwC was ranked somewhere in the top 15 to 20 companies prior to engaging Starfish. After which PwC was ranked in the top 5 and eventually number 1. Campus recruitment has been a definite win.

We've been able to raise our specific metrics such as increasing readership on our website and other materials, as well as increasing awareness with the industry analyst program. The creative work and its alignment with our brand have delivered a strong and clear message that has had a huge impact.

How did Starfish perform from a project management standpoint?

This is an area of strength for Starfish. Their project management team is exceptional from listening, updating timelines, maintaining budget and troubleshooting roadblocks. This, along with interpersonal skill, is one of the reasons why Starfish has been with me for 15 years,

PwC is a tough and demanding client. In order for any agency to operate in it for any length of time, it has to be at the top of its game, continually demonstrating added value for fees.

**O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E**
What challenge were you trying to address with Starfish?

Two and a half years ago, HP split from a larger company into two smaller companies. We needed to develop a new people strategy that could be articulated to all employees. Our employees have varied job roles, from marketing and customer support to scientists, developers, and engineers. The people strategy needs to make sense and be relatable to everyone.

**SOLUTION**
What was the scope of their involvement?

HP asked five workstreams to develop white papers based on various aspects of our people strategy: Talent Acquisition, Talent and Learning, Our Culture, Rewards and Recognition, and The Future of Work. We provided the white papers to Starfish and they developed a cohesive format that made each workstream make sense within the broader strategy. Starfish boiled down the white papers to an articulation of the role of each workstream and their goals for the future. They had access to the leaders of each of the workstreams so they could ask questions and get clarification as needed.

Starfish produced two versions of what we call the HR strategy book. One is a 38-page printed and digital version that went to all of HR. The second is an eight-page executive version that was created for all HP employees. They developed the branding and brand strategy for both books.

### Weight Watchers
Upon engaging Starfish, Weight Watchers was losing market share to free apps and was seeing a sharp decline in membership. Our brand experience research revealed people’s experience was best defined as “your mother’s diet brand."
In response to the market conditions, a new, holistic program called "Beyond The Scale" was developed. Starfish worked to architect a unified brand experience that delivered on the holistic nature of the new BTS program. It was recognized that a wholesale shift in culture was a prerequisite in order to successfully deliver this new consumer experience.
Thus, Starfish designed a completely integrated brand experience for WW by conducting a member segmentation study, developing journey maps, creating optimization programs for three key segments, forming a cultural alignment program, and defining Weight Watcher's desired brand experience as: “A healthier, more confident version of myself.”

### Dunkin Donuts
Dunkin’ was never just about donuts. Its legendary coffee was part of a power couple that dominated QSR. But with a long-running campaign focused on donuts, Dunkin’ was eclipsing its core coffee business, giving brand diehards a reason to get their caffeine fix elsewhere. 
Starfish was engaged by Dunkin Donuts to assist with a transition of the organization from a donut shop back to a coffee company. 
The initiatives employed surrounded cultural, product and services and a host of environmental elements. 
Starfish facilitated and guided a successful rollout of a multi-faceted “America Runs on Dunkin” coffee-centric brand experience program.

### Avis Budget Group
A driving force behind the success of the AVIS brand was its legendary “We Try Harder” ad campaign. But the awareness of the brand’s relentless spirit for serving its customers continuously faded when it stopped running the advertising. In a highly competitive and heavy ad spend category, a marquis brand had lost its distinct positioning.  
The challenge? Restore the AVIS brand and its key point of differentiation by demonstrating its core attribute of “trying harder.”
Our team delivered a complete rebrand, with a new strategy, identity, messaging and web development; Red Stops At Nothing; a campaign fueled by the brand's legendary commitment to customer service.

### Leaf Vodka
Ukraine’s #1 liquor company, Global Spirits, had immense success with its Moroshka brand of vodka whose main point of difference is that it is made with nature’s purest ingredients and water from the Carpathian Mountains. 
Intent on leveraging its learning and success in the U.S., the company developed LEAF and wanted to position it as “Organic Vodka.” However, the U.S. vodka market consists of hundreds of brands, not to mention the thousands that have failed along the way. 
The challenge? With an identity as thin as water and no celebrity endorsement, we were tasked with creating a brand from scratch. The inspiration behind the brand: water. We leaned into the idea that water is the spirit of life and therefore the spirit of vodka and that the makers of LEAF search the globe for the world’s purest water, enabling them to make the cleanest-tasting vodka.
